FAYETTEVILLE, N.C.- Methodist
College
Baseball and Softball programs both
produced USA South Conference
Championships this spring.
They also both produced Methodist College's top
scholastic student-athletes in Steve Cornelius and Kayla
Talbert. The duo claimed the honor of 2005-06 Methodist
College Male and Female Scholar Athlete of the Year, as
announced today by Methodist athletics director Bob McEvoy.
The annual award is given to the
male and female student-athlete with the highest GPA based upon
the fall and spring semesters of that year (it is not
cumulative). The recipients must be varsity athletes, full-time
students for both semesters and the two-semester GPA must be at
least 3.2. The awards are to be presented at the first
Convocation in the following fall.
Cornelius, a junior from
Clarksville, MD repeats as Scholar Athlete of the Year, having
won the honor in 2004-05 as well. He is majoring in
business administration and carries a 4.09 GPA.
Talbert is a freshman from
Winston-Salem, NC. The Mount Tabor High School graduate
played third base for the Monarchs this season.
